Successful Intarsia demonstration

Cathy Wise, International Intarsia artist, was well received last week. She made the platypus with such speed the audience were blown away. It is exciting watching a skilled expert. Wether members take up the art or not she had lots of useful tips that could be used in other areas.

Cathy prepared well for her tour as she designed plans for many Australian animals.

Wood Sale

The Club has been lucky enough to be given a large amount of various timbers. This wood has been generously donated by a local family. We have also been given a quantity of turned segmented bowls.  Over the next few weeks, you will see these timbers stockpiled at the workshop. The wood includes Huon Pine, Silky Oak, Nectarine and a large range of other exotic timbers.

This wood is for sale now until sold out to all members at an extremely low cost. Money raised from sales will go directly to the club to buy more equipment for the members to use.
